Wed Oct 02 19:58:18 UTC 2024: ## India Eyes World Cup Glory as T20 Women’s World Cup Kicks Off

With the Women’s T20 World Cup 2024 set to begin, teams are gearing up for the mega event. India, who missed out on the Asia Cup trophy, is focused on securing the World Cup title. While India starts its campaign on October 4th against New Zealand, the real test will be on October 13th against Australia.

Team India’s vice-captain, Smriti Mandhana, acknowledged the challenge of facing Australia, stating that there are no shortcuts to defeating the reigning champions. Australia has dominated the tournament, claiming the trophy for three consecutive years, including a final victory over India in 2023.

“Every World Cup match is crucial and we need to give it our all,” Mandhana said ahead of the tournament. “New Zealand and Sri Lanka are strong teams, but against Australia, there is no room for error. We need to bring our A-game to the match against them. They are the best team and beating them will be a huge challenge.”

The excitement for the tournament extends beyond the India-Australia clash. The India-Pakistan match on October 6th is another highly anticipated encounter, with both teams’ fans deeply invested in the rivalry. “The India-Pakistan competition is special because both teams’ supporters have strong emotions,” Mandhana commented. “Although players interact, the passion from both countries makes it a thrilling encounter.”

India will look to make their mark on the World Cup and reclaim the trophy from Australia. With the tournament kicking off soon, fans are eagerly anticipating thrilling encounters and a chance to witness the world’s best female cricketers in action.
